After 40 years in business, Reisterstown's historic Ski Shoppe is closing its doors. 

The Ski Shoppe Ltd. opened in 1976. Its founder, Gerry Brown, was an avid skier and sport enthusiast. The shop is located in an historic building on the corner of Main Street and Cockeys Mill Road.

The store announced its closing via Facebook. The going out of business sale began Tuesday and goes through Sunday. All merchandise is marked down 30 to 50 percent.
